ONLY LOCAL TALENT WILL BE ACCEPTED. Seeking talent ages 9-14 for a coming of age short film "Al Mushata". Please, see the details below. About the project: On the Eve of her 6th grade graduation photos, a young sudanese-canadian girl's ruined hairstyle forces her mother to reconnect her with their cultural roots, one braid at a time. Rate: Non union. Paid. Additional information: Seeking Sudanese/West Sudanese talent. Shooting dates: September 18-20, 2026. Location: Toronto, ON. Submission Deadline: August 13, 2026. Nadia is an uptight pre-teen navigating identity and yearning for a sense of belonging. a perfectionist of sorts, she is focused on presenting herself in a way that aligns with an idealized version of the girl she wants to be. stubborn, determined, and deeply connected to her family, nadia's journey leads her to discover the person she is meant to become through the hairstyle of "al kirib".
